Damaged tile replacement services involve removing broken, cracked, or otherwise compromised tiles and installing new ones in their place. This process typically begins with carefully assessing the affected area to determine the extent of damage. The replacement tiles are then precisely cut and fitted to match the existing pattern and style, ensuring a seamless appearance.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to minimize disruption and ensure the new tiles adhere properly, resulting in a finish that restores both the aesthetic appeal and functionality of the space.

This service addresses a variety of common problems, including cracked or chipped tiles, loose tiles that pose safety hazards, and tiles that have become stained or discolored beyond cleaning. Damaged tiles can compromise the integrity of flooring or wall surfaces, leading to potential water infiltration or further deterioration if left unaddressed. Replacing damaged tiles helps prevent more extensive repairs down the line and maintains the overall condition of the property. It also enhances the visual appeal of the space, restoring a clean and uniform look.

The overview below groups typical Damaged Tile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Bend County,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- The cost to replace damaged tiles typ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on tile size and material. For example, replacing a few broken ceramic tiles might cost around $350, while extensive damage could reach $1,000 or more.

Material Expenses - The type of tile chosen influences the overall cost, with standard ceramic tiles costing about $3 to $7 per square foot. Higher-end options like natural stone or porcelain can increase material expenses significantly.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for damaged tile replacement us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the extent of the damage and the complexity of the removal and installation process.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include grout, adhesive, and disposal fees, which can add $50 to $200 to the total cost. These costs vary based on the size of the area and spec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es tile damage that requires replacement? Common causes include impact from heavy objects, water damage, cracks from shifting foundations, and aging or wear over time.

How can I tell if a tile needs to be replaced? Signs include visible cracks, chips, looseness, or water stains around the tile area.

Are damaged tiles safe to walk on? Damaged tiles can be a safety hazard due to sharp edges or looseness and should be inspected by a professional.

What types of tiles can be replaced? Most types, including 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one tiles, can be replaced depending on the existing installation.

How do local pros handle damaged tile replacement? They assess the damage, remove the broken tile, prepare the surface, and install a new tile to match the existing pattern and style.
